Camped here for one night. Staff helpful and friendly. Site situated on a lovely beach with wonderful walks around the corner. Short drive from a lovely village/town with good amenities. Good laundry station. Kitchen facilities good if you bring your own pots/pans. Do have to pay for the showers but they are worth it. Wi-Fi is excellent. Toilets are very modern and clean. Well maintained, large pitches. $25 unpowered 1 person, friendly staff. No need for wrist band (must be school holidays only?). Great location, quiet at night. Kitchen; 2 large fridges, hot water urn, hobs. Bring your own pots/ pans etc. clean toilets & showers ($1 for latter). Codes required to get into toilet /shower block - I assume to stop non-campers from using them given the beachfront location. There are some signs saying ‘no’ but they’re sensible and not a problem.
